5 / 171 page 5 8168B-MCU Wireless-02/09 AT86RF212 Pins Name Type Description 10 DIG2 Digital output 1. Antenna Diversity RF switch control (DIG1 inverted), see section 9.3 2. Signal IRQ_2 (RX_START) for RX Frame Time Stamping, see section 9.5 If disabled, internally pulled to DVSS 11 SLP_TR Digital input Controls sleep, transmit start, receive states; active high, see section 4.6 12 DVSS Ground Digital ground 13 DVDD Analog Regulated 1.8 V internal supply voltage; digital domain, see section 7.5 14 DVDD Analog Regulated 1.8 V internal supply voltage; digital domain, see section 7.5 15 DEVDD Supply External supply voltage; digital domain 16 DVSS Ground Digital ground 17 CLKM Digital output Master clock signal output; low if disabled, see section 7.7 18 DVSS Ground Digital ground 19 SCLK Digital input SPI clock 20 MISO Digital output SPI data output (master input slave output) 21 DVSS Ground Digital ground 22 MOSI Digital input SPI data input (master output slave input) 23 /SEL Digital input SPI select, active low 24 IRQ Digital output 1. Interrupt request signal; active high or active low, see section 4.7 2. Buffer-level mode indicator; active high 25 XTAL2 Analog Crystal pin, see sections 2.2.1.3 and 7.7 26 XTAL1 Analog Crystal pin or external clock supply, see section 2.2.1.3 and 7.7 27 AVSS Ground Analog ground 28 EVDD Supply External supply voltage; analog domain 29 AVDD Analog Regulated 1.8 V internal supply voltage; analog domain, see section 7.5 30 AVSS Ground Analog ground 31 AVSS Ground Analog ground 32 AVSS Ground Analog ground Paddle AVSS Ground Analog ground; exposed paddle of QFN package 2.2.1 Analog and RF Pins 2.2.1.1 Supply and Ground Pins EVDD, DEVDD EVDD and DEVDD are analog and digital supply voltage pins of the AT86RF212 radio transceiver. AVDD, DVDD AVDD and DVDD are outputs of the internal voltage regulators and require bypass capacitors for stable operation. The voltage regulators are controlled independently by the radio transceivers state machine and are activated depending on the current radio transceiver state. The voltage regulators can be configured for external supply. For details refer to section 7.5. AVSS, DVSS AVSS and DVSS are analog and digital ground pins respectively. |
